What getVASPList does on Bybit MCP Server

AI agents call getVASPList to retrieve information from Bybit MCP Server without modifying anything. It is typically the context-gathering step in research, monitoring, and reporting workflows, before the agent takes action elsewhere.

Why getVASPList is rated Low

This tool retrieves regulatory/compliance information (a list of Virtual Asset Service Providers) to inform user decisions about withdrawals. It performs a pure read operation with no capability to modify data, execute transactions, delete records, or trigger external actions. The low severity reflects that misuse would only expose informational data rather than cause operational or financial harm.

From the tool's definition Tool description states 'Query the list of available VASPs' — a query operation that retrieves data without modification. The description explicitly indicates this is used for compliance checking and information lookup, with no side effects.

Can I rate-limit getVASPList? +

Yes. Add a rate_limit block to the getVASPList rule in your PolicyLayer policy. For example, setting max: 10 and window: 60 limits the tool to 10 calls per minute. Rate limits are tracked per agent session and reset automatically.

How do I block getVASPList completely? +

Set action: deny in the PolicyLayer policy for getVASPList. The AI agent will receive a policy violation error and cannot call the tool. You can also include a reason field to explain why the tool is blocked.
